
The old woman did not know how to operate smart TV?
A video of a man teaching an elderly woman to operate a smart TV is going viral on social media. The clip, which was originally posted on TikTok and re-shared on Twitter on Thursday, shows a man explaining various streaming apps on a smart TV to an elderly woman.

In the video, the man explains to the woman how to find different OTT (over the top) platforms on a smart television. He tells her that all the categories that appear on the television screen have their own separate apps. From Amazon Prime to Netflix, the man explains that they have nothing to do with each other, but are all apps.

The man says, “We have Prime Video and we have Netflix,” then he instructs her to find Netflix on the screen, after which the older woman goes to the streaming app and learns to open it.
Twitter user Chris Evans shared the video on Twitter with the caption, “How do I sign my parents up for this tutorial?”
This post, shared just a few days ago, has been viewed more than 4 million times so far and has received more than 288,000 likes.
